搜索到与相关的文章
Windows

《Windows核心编程系列》十异步IO之IO完成端口

http://blog.csdn.net/ithzhang/article/details/8508161转载请注明出处!!IO完成端口为了将Windows打造成一个出色的服务器环境,Microsoft开发出了IO完成端口。完成端口需要与线程池配合使用。完成端口背后的理论是并发运行的线程数量必须有一个上限。由于太多的线程将会导致系统花费很大的代价在各个线程cpu上下文进行切换。使用并发模型与创建进程相比开销要低很多,但是也需要为每个

系统 2019-08-29 22:51:15 2950

编程技术

深入理解Magento – 第二章 – Magento请求分发

深入理解Magento作者:AlanStorm翻译:HailongZhang第二章–Magento请求分发与控制器Model-View-Controller(MVC),模型-视图-控制器,源于Smalltalk编程语言和XeroxParc。现在有很多系统是基于MVC架构的,不同的系统MVC的实现也略有不同,但都体现了MVC的精髓,分离数据,业务逻辑和显示逻辑。最常见的PHPMVC框架是这样的URL请求被一个PHP文件拦截,通常称为前端控制器(FrontCo

系统 2019-08-29 22:36:10 2950

编程技术

让浏览插上翅膀 给IE加个参数体验新惊喜

http://tech.sina.com.cn/s/2006-02-07/0829834415.shtml作者:比目鱼众所周知,IE浏览器的主程序是Iexplore.exe,和许多软件一样,我们也可以给该文件加上参数使用,有时会有意想不到的效果。首先我们说说怎样给IE的主程序Iexplore.exe加上参数。打开“我的电脑”,找到IE的安装目录,假设你的IE安装在C:/ProgramFiles/InternetExplorer下。进入该文件夹,找到Iexp

系统 2019-08-29 22:33:26 2950

各行各业

Deployment of VC2008 apps without installing

IfyoucreateadefaultCRT/MFCapplicationwithVS2008,thisapplicationwillnotrunonothercomputers.Youapplicationwillcomplainwith“Thisapplicationhasfailedtostartbecausetheapplicationconfigurationisincorrect”.TheproblemisthatbydefaultVC2008

系统 2019-08-12 09:27:24 2950

MySql

MySQL学习(二)复制

复制解决的问题是保持多个服务器之间的数据的一致性,就如同通过复制保持两个文件的一致性一样,只不过MySQL的复制要相对要复杂一些,其基本过程如下:1)在主库上将数据更改记录到二进制日志(BinaryLog)中(这些记录被成为二进制日志事件,即binlog)2)本分将主库上的日志复制到自己的中继日志(RelayLog)中3)备库读取中继日志中的事件,将其重放到备库数据之上。从上面可以看出,复制需要四个进程或线程做事情:主库保存日志、主库根据备库的请求转储日志

系统 2019-08-12 01:54:45 2950

数据库相关

内存数据库 MonetDB

内存数据库MonetDB分享到新浪微博腾讯微博已用+1收藏+29MonetDB是一个内存数据库原型系统,它侧重于支持查询密集型应用,如数据挖掘、即时决策支持等。它是从主存储器观点开发而来的数据管理系统,使用一个完全分解的存储模块,自动的标题管理,数据类型和搜索加速器的可延伸性,以及SQL-和XML-前台。功能和特点◆支持SQL’99,SQL’03核心标准◆支持持久存储,触发器◆用户可用C编写所需功能◆支持OPEN-GIS标准◆支持SQL/XML大部分标准◆

系统 2019-08-12 01:54:39 2950

数据库相关

一次sqlldr性能测试案例

$sqlldrSQL*Loader:Release10.2.0.1.0-ProductiononTueMay1916:06:212009Copyright(c)1982,2005,Oracle.Allrightsreserved.Usage:SQLLDRkeyword=value[,keyword=value,...]ValidKeywords:userid--ORACLEusername/passwordcontrol--controlfilenamel

系统 2019-08-12 01:54:11 2950

数据库相关

遇过的坑(2)—MyISAM表类型不支持事务操作

最近需要通过JDBC对数据库做事务型操作,实践时发现,并没有达到想要的效果,表现在:1、每次执行executeUpdate()后,数据就马上能在DB中查到。但按理来说,我还没执行commit(),DB中不应该有这个数据;2、执行rollback()时,数据也没回滚。定位问题后,发现是数据库表类型在作祟:当时设定的“表类型”为MyISAM,而这种类型,是不支持事务操作的。能够支持事务操作的表类型是“InnoDB",修改表类型为”InnoDB"后,事务操作终于

系统 2019-08-12 01:53:48 2950

Tomcat

tomcat的结构

tomcat的结构顶层类元素:可包含多个Service顶层类元素:可包含一个Engine,多个Connector连接器类元素:代表通信接口容器类元素:为特定的Service组件处理所有客户请求,可包含多个Host。容器类元素:为特定的虚拟主机处理所有客户请求可包含多个Context。容器类元素:为特定的Web应用处理所有客户请求

系统 2019-08-12 01:33:57 2950

编程技术

读取文档时避免文档中因汉字儿出现乱码

StreamReadersd=newStreamReader(path,Encoding.GetEncoding("gb2312"));stringsd=File.ReadAllText(path,Encoding.GetEncoding("gb2312"));StreamReadersd=File.ReadAllText(path,GetEncoding("gb2312"));读取文档时避免文档中因汉字儿出现乱码

系统 2019-08-12 01:33:45 2950